    According to a list compiled by LoveFood , the most expensive place to dine in all of Florida is Victoria & Albert's in Orlando. Just one menu item at Victoria & Albert's can run you over $400!

    Here's what LoveFood had to say about the most expensive place to dine in the entire state:

    "Walt Disney World is famous for its candy apples and giant turkey legs, but did you know it also has a spot where you can spend over $400 on dinner? Victoria & Albert's, the jewel in the crown of Disney's Grand Floridian Resort & Spa, proves there really is something for everyone at the House of Mouse. The restaurant is highly acclaimed, earning both a Michelin star and a Forbes Travel Guide Five-Star Rating in 2024. Here, guests buckle up for an epic four-hour experience, complete with delicate patisserie, melt-in-the-mouth wagyu, and multiple bread courses. The tasting menus start at around $300 but can cost over $400."
